Henderson High School (Mississippi)

Henderson High School was a public secondary school in Starkville, Mississippi. United States. It served as the high school for black students until the public schools were integrated in 1970. Grades k8 were also located on the same property. After integration, the buildings served as a junior high school and later as an elementary school.
